Bexleyheath is home to the borough’s largest shopping facility, where you’ll find high-street names, and supermarkets. There’s a bowling alley, a cinema, Crook Log Leisure Centre, regular specialist markets and family-friendly restaurants too.
Families are also attracted to Bexleyheath for the schooling – with two of the borough’s grammars and excellent primaries close by. The Red House – an Arts & Crafts property designed for the artist and socialist William Morris - is Bexleyheath’s premier cultural attraction.
